Claims (1)

【実用新案登録請求の範囲】[Scope of utility model registration request] ウィンチ又はブーム俯仰の為の巻下げ動力を油圧、電気
又は機械的に検出し、走行又は旋回ポンプの吐出量を上
記検出量に比例して減するようにしたことを特徴とする
半油圧移動式クレーンの油圧回路。
A semi-hydraulic mobile type, characterized in that the lowering power for raising and lowering the winch or boom is detected hydraulically, electrically or mechanically, and the discharge amount of the travel or swing pump is reduced in proportion to the detected amount. Crane hydraulic circuit.
